High-Quality Industrial Di-Tert-Butyl Peroxide 98% Supplier & Factory in China - CAS 110-05-4

DTBP, a premium liquid dialkyl peroxide, serves as an efficient initiator for the polymerization of olefins and acrylic resins. Additionally, it acts as a modification agent for PP degradation. With a specific gravity (D20of 0.7940, a melting point of -40°C, and a flash point of 65°C (open), DTBP boasts a refractive index (n20D) of 1.3890 and a boiling point of 111°C. This product is insoluble in water but soluble in benzene, light petroleum, and toluene, and is stable at normal temperatures.     Half Life Data

    Activation Energy
    35.1 kcal/mole
    10hr. Half Life Temp
    126℃
    1hr. Half Life Temp
    149℃
    1min. Half Life Temp
    193℃

    Product Introduction

    PRODUCThrt
    DTBP
    Chemical Name Di-tert-Butyl peroxide
    Molecular Formula C8H18O2
    Molecular Weight 146.23
    CAS NO. 110-05-4
    UN NO. 3107
    EINECS 203-733-6

    Specification

    Test Item Limit
    Assay Min.98.5%
    Color Max.40Hazen
    Fe Max.0.0003%

    Package and Storage

    Package: 20kg, net, PE drum.
    Storage: Below 30℃ stored under shadow, good air circulation.

    Applications

    Crosslinking Agent

    DTBP is used as a crosslinking agent in the production of unsaturated polyester resins and silicone rubbers.

    Polymerization Initiator

    It serves as a polymerization initiator in the production of polymers such as polystyrene and polyethylene.

    Plasticizer

    DTBP is used in the modification of polypropylene to improve its properties.

    Vulcanizing Agent

    It is employed as a vulcanizing agent in the rubber industry.

    Oxidant in Organic Synthesis

    In the field of organic chemistry, DTBP can act as an oxidant, facilitating reactions such as the esterification of primary benzylic C-H bonds with carboxylic acids.

    Food Processing

    It has been used as a bleaching agent in the food industry, although its use in this area may be restricted due to safety concerns.

    Diesel and Lubricant Additives

    DTBP is used as an additive in diesel and lubricants to improve their properties.

    Transformer Dew Point Reducing Agent

    It can be used to lower the pour point of transformer oils.

    Chemical Production

    DTBP is an important substance in chemical production, with applications in olefin polymerization and improving anti-knock properties.
